Curso Grátis de HTML, CSS e JS. Criando um Sistema Para Pizzaria

Curso Grátis de HTML, CSS e JS. Criando um Sistema Para Pizzaria

Para qual e-mail devo enviar a aula?

Fique Tranquilo. Seu e-mail está 100% seguro!

Crie Sistemas Incríveis Com os Melhores Frameworks Front-End

Crie Sistemas Incríveis Com os Melhores Frameworks Front-End

Quais os Melhores Frameworks Front-End do Mercado? Descubra Neste Artigo e Crie Sistemas Incríveis Com os 7 Melhores Frameworks Disponíveis Gratuitamente.

Se você é um desenvolvedor de sistemas web ou de aplicativos, sabe o tempo que levamos para produzir uma aplicação ou uma solução para nossos clientes. O processo de desenvolvimento de sistemas ou de criação de sites específicos podem levar dias, semanas ou até meses para ser concluído dependendo do projeto.

Mas como os avanços da tecnologia, o processo de criação e desenvolvimento de softwares, aplicativos e sites podem ser muito mais ágil na execução do projeto. Estamos falando dos Frameworks!

Hoje os frameworks vêm ajudando muito as comunidades de programadores de software, isso porque agiliza e disponibiliza bibliotecas prontas e encapsuladas que eliminam processos que até então eram trabalhosos ao implementar do zero e que precisaria ser refeita sempre.

Entenda o Que é Framework 

Resumidamente, definimos um framework como uma ferramenta de apoio no processo de desenvolvimento de softwares, capaz de entregar muitas funcionalidades já “prontas” para o programador.

Ao invés de se criar tudo do zero a cada projeto novo, com os frameworks não há mais esta necessidade, basta o programador importar a biblioteca e pronto, o layout ou a função já estará disponível.

Um exemplo da utilização do framework: no projeto, tem-se a necessidade de criar um layout (interface) no front-end do sistema ou do aplicativo mobile. O programador precisa ganhar tempo para entregar o projeto, e não quer criar tudo do zero os estilos CSS e as funcionalidades JAVASCRIPT, então ele instala ou importa as bibliotecas principais do framework escolhido ao seu projeto e pronto, todo o designer, validações de formulários, etc já estarão prontas e o ganho de tempo será imenso.

Percebeu o tempo ganho pelo programador no desenvolvimento do front-end da aplicação? Então, essas são uma das grandes vantagens de se trabalhar com framework. Não sabe o que é front-end? Calma! Vou te explicar.

Mas antes saiba disso: existem diversos frameworks disponíveis no mercado, desde os pagos como os gratuitos. Neste artigo você vai conhecer os melhores frameworks gratuitos utilizados em grandes projetos por ai.

Entenda o Que é Front-End

O termo front-end surge para definir os escopos de responsabilidades de um projeto. Este termo é utilizado no mundo da TI (tecnologia da informação), mas vem sendo bastante usado também por diversos setores de mercados diferentes, sendo numa reunião com equipes ou ao fazer um briefing.

Para o nosso mercado de atuação (desenvolvimento de sistemas), a definição de front-end é toda a parte do designer, layout, “aparência” do projeto, ou seja, do site ou aplicativo que está disponível para o cliente acessar e interagir. Em outras palavras são as telas da aplicação disponibilizada para os usuários.

Veja: Como Criar Sistemas e Ganhar Dinheiro Como Programador PHP

Nesse contexto, dizemos que os frameworks front-end é utilizado como ferramentas que nos auxiliam neste processo de criação das interfaces e na forma como os dados são exibidos. Por isso, eles se tornam muito relevantes, já que facilitam e muito o processo de desenvolvimento.

Então ficou claro? Em poucas palavras front-end é o seu site, o aplicativo por “fora” que interage com o usuário.

Agora vamos conhecer os melhores frameworks font-end disponíveis no mercado gratuitamente para ajudar no desenvolvimento de sistemas web e mobile.

7 Melhores Frameworks Front-End Para Seu Projeto Web

1 – Bootstrap

Este pra mim é o melhor framework quando se trata de criação de projetos front-end. Tanto pela facilidade de utilização quanto as grandes possibilidades e funcionalidades que a biblioteca nos possibilita agregar ao projeto.

Com muita facilidade você cria projetos responsivos para dispositivos móveis e também web com uma das bibliotecas de componentes front-end mais populares do mundo.

A ferramenta Bootstrap é gratuita e é usada nos projetos que utiliza-se HTML, CSS e JAVASCRIPT.  Pode-se criar protótipos rapidamente ou aplicações completas utilizando as variáveis e os sistemas de grid responsivo, além de entregar poderosos plug-ins jQuery.

Visite o site do Bootstrap e conheça essa maravilhosa ferramenta.

2 – Foundation

A Foundation é um excelente framework focado na criação de sites, aplicativos e e-mail responsivos. Seu layout é excelente e muito bem fácil de ser manuseado pelo usuário.

Sua base é semântica e bem legível, além de ser flexível e totalmente personalizável. A empresa Foundation constantemente atualiza e adiciona novos recursos e códigos para agilizar o processo de modelagem HTML.

Acesse o site da Foundation e veja sua funcionalidades e possibilidades.

3 – Semantic UI

Outro framework disponível no mercado é o Semantic UI. Esta biblioteca ajuda a criar layouts bonitos e responsivos usando o HTML amigável.

Este framework se destaca na utilização de LESS e jQuery. Com essas duas tecnologias, o resultado final da aplicação web é bastante interessante, sendo de fácil manuseio pelo usuário final.

Faça um teste adicionando o Semantic UI ao seu projeto e desfrute com um layout muito interessante, botões, cards, ícones, menus, dropdowns e muito mais.

4 – Monaca

Quando se trata em desenvolvimento de aplicativos focado em mobile, o Monaca é uma boa opção. Este framework é bastante poderoso na criação de telas para celulares para várias plataformas.

O Monaca auxilia nos trabalhos que envolvem a utilização do Cordova no seu projeto para a criação de aplicativos móveis híbridos. Este framework vai ajudar você reunir todo o processo em um ambiente simples baseado em nuvem, além de oferecer recursos e ferramentas para otimizar tempo no seu desenvolvimento.

Conheça: Aprenda a Criar Aplicativos Com React Native, Clique Aqui.

5 – Materialize

Outro excelente framework que recomendo é o Materialize, que vem sendo famoso entre os programadores front-end. Esta biblioteca de funcionalidades espetaculares está sendo um dos mais solicitados como pré-requisito nas vagas de emprego para designers e programadores.

Materialize é um framework front-end que utiliza o Material Design como base de inspiração para cores, ícones, botões e formatos. Permite também ser baixado ou acessado via CDN com um simples comando.

Conheça esta incrível biblioteca de funcionalidades e adicione-a ao seu projeto. Você vai se surpreender com os layouts fantásticos e incríveis.

6 – Milligram

Outro framework disponível no mercado gratuitamente é o Milligram. Este Framework fornece uma excelente configuração de estilos rápido e limpo para uma interface bacana.

Além disso, o framework é projetado para melhor desempenho e maior produtividade com menos propriedades para redefinir, resultando em código mais limpo. Espero que goste!

Acesse o site do Milligram para conhecer esta biblioteca de layout e adicione ao seu projeto.

7 – Pure.css

Agora você precisa de um framework leve, com uma interface de botões limpos e simples? Estão este framework é uma boa recomendação. O Pure.css é um conjunto de pequenos módulos CSS responsivos que você pode usar em todos seus projetos.

Quem desenvolveu esta biblioteca foi a equipe de desenvolvedores da Yahoo. A ideia do Pure.css é ser uma matriz leve com módulos CSS que podem ser usados ​​em praticamente qualquer projeto.

Não é complicado de aprende-lo e importa-lo ao seu projeto. Você pode criar facilmente botões, menus, grades, tabelas e outros recursos responsivos, isso porque é puramente baseado em CSS, no entanto, ele não suporta plugins JavaScript ou jQuery.

Faça um teste com o Pure.css e verifique se este framework é ideal para o seu projeto. Faça um bom uso!

 

E ai, gostou? Agora é com você! Teste estes frameworks e escolha a melhor opção que atenderá ao seu projeto. Você pode utilizar estes frameworks para criar sites, lojas virtuais (e-commerce), aplicativos, sistemas e aplicações web e muito mais.

Leia Também: O que é PHP? [Descubra Porque Aprender]

Tags: | | | | | | | | | | | | | | | |

0 Comentários

Deixe uma resposta

O seu endereço de e-mail não será publicado.

Esse site utiliza o Akismet para reduzir spam. Aprenda como seus dados de comentários são processados.